How do you campaign for Haiti’s parliament when you are one of America’s most wanted men? Well, one-time coup leader Guy Philippe — indicted in Miami on drug-trafficking charges — may soon provide the answer.

Officials on Tuesday were investigating why a man with a Cuban passport was aboard a boat that illegally took eight Haitian migrants to a beach in Palm Beach County, according to law enforcement officials.

Dominican authorities began to issue documents to Haitians who work illegally in agriculture, construction and livestock in the north and northwest, to regulate the foreign manpower, said an official source …
